Exhibit A

ROIC Performance Units

Vesting Provisions

1. Vesting Date. The term “Vesting Date” means, with respect to the vesting of Performance Units pursuant to this Exhibit A, [INSERT DATE], provided, however, that, in the event the Participant’s Termination Date occurs due to death or Disability, the “Vesting Date” shall be the Participant’s Termination Date; and provided further that, if a Change in Control occurs, the “Vesting Date” shall be determined under paragraph 4. The amount of Shares to be paid out shall be determined in accordance with paragraph 2, 3 or 4 as applicable. Dividend equivalents shall be paid on all Shares paid out upon vesting pursuant to Section 7 of the Performance Unit Agreement.

2. ROIC Peer Group Rank. The Performance Criterion applicable to the Award is return on invested capital, or “ROIC” as more fully described in your Notice of Award. In determining the actual number of Shares to be paid out pursuant to this Exhibit A on the Vesting Date, the Committee shall determine the Company’s average ROIC (as defined in your Notice of Award) over the four years comprising the Performance Period (i.e., the arithmetic mean of ROICs for the four individual years) and compare such number against the average ROIC for the companies included in the Peer Group (as defined in your Notice of Award). The performance and payout scale is set forth in your Notice of Award.

As described in your Notice of Award, after the end of the Performance Period, the Committee shall determine the Company’s performance against the Peer Group and the number of Shares to be paid out upon vesting and the Company shall pay out such number of Shares in settlement of this Award. Such payment and settlement shall occur as soon as practicable following the applicable Vesting Date but in no event later than 2-1/2 months following the year in which the applicable Vesting Date occurs.

3. Vesting Upon Death, Disability or Retirement. In the event that the Participant’s Termination Date occurs prior to the Vesting Date occurring on [DATE] as specified in paragraph 1 on account of death, Disability or Retirement, the Performance Units shall vest as provided below:

(a) If the Participant’s Termination Date occurs due to death or Disability, the Performance Units shall vest as of the Termination Date (which shall be the Vesting Date set forth in paragraph 1) and the number of Shares to be paid out to such Participant shall be equal to the number that would be paid out pursuant to paragraph 2 based upon performance through the end of the calendar year immediately preceding the Termination Date; provided, however, that if the Termination Date occurs as a result of death or Disability prior to the end of the first full calendar year in the Performance Period, the number of Shares to be paid out shall equal 100% of the number of Performance Units.

(b) If the Participant’s Termination Date occurs due to Retirement (as defined below), the Performance Units shall vest on the Vesting Date occurring on [DATE] as specified in paragraph 1 (notwithstanding that the Participant’s Termination Date has occurred prior to such date) provided that (1) the date of Retirement occurs at least twelve months after the Grant Date, (2)


the Participant provides the Company with advance written notice of the Participant’s date of Retirement at least twelve months prior to the actual date of Retirement (and such date of Retirement does not occur prior to the date specified in the advance written notice), and (3) the Participant has entered into a restrictive covenant agreement (“Restrictive Covenant Agreement”) with the Company on or prior to the Termination Date and complies with the terms thereof. For the avoidance of doubt, continued vesting of the Performance Units following the Participant’s Retirement shall be in consideration of the Participant entering into a Restrictive Covenant Agreement. The number of Shares to be paid out shall be determined pursuant paragraph 2 based upon actual performance through the entire Performance Period.

For purposes of this Award, the term “Retirement” means the Participant’s Termination Date that occurs on or after the date on which (A) the Participant has reached at least age 55 and (B) the sum of the Participant’s age and service with the Company and its Subsidiaries equals at least 70 and if the Termination Date does not occur for any other reason.

4. Vesting Upon Change in Control. If a Change in Control occurs prior to the applicable Vesting Date determined pursuant to paragraph 1 or 3, the then outstanding Performance Units shall vest, with the “Vesting Date” being the date of such Change in Control. In such case, the number of Shares to be paid out shall equal the number that would be paid out pursuant to paragraph 2 based upon performance through the end of the calendar year immediately preceding such Change in Control. If such Change in Control occurs prior to the end of the first full calendar year in the Performance Period, the number of Shares to be paid out shall equal 100% of the number of Performance Units. The number of Shares to be paid out pursuant to a Change in Control as determined pursuant to the previous two sentences shall be defined as the “Change in Control Vest Amount.” Notwithstanding the foregoing, the Performance Units shall not vest and shall not be paid out upon a Change in Control if an award meeting the following requirements (the “Replacement Award”) is provided in substitution hereof:

 

  (i)

it relates to equity securities of the Company or its successor following the Change in Control or another entity that is affiliated with the Company or its successor following the Change in Control and such equity securities are publicly traded and registered under the Securities Exchange Act of 1934;

 

  (ii)

it has a value at least equal to the value of this Award as of the date of the Change in Control as determined by the Committee, assuming payout at the Change in Control Vest Amount;

 

  (iii)

it does not contain any performance goals and shall be paid out at the Change in Control Vest Amount subject only to continued service with the Company or its successor (and their affiliates) following the Change in Control through the [fourth anniversary of the Grant Date];

 

  (iv)

its forfeiture provisions, transfer restrictions and any other restrictions lapse upon the applicable Vesting Date determined under this Award; provided, however, that such restrictions shall lapse, and the Award shall fully vest and be paid out at the Change in Control Vest Amount, if within two years after the date of the Change in Control, the Participant’s Termination Date occurs as a result of termination by the Company (or its successor) without Cause or the Participant’s resignation for Good Reason; and


  (v)

the other terms and conditions of the Replacement Award relating to service conditions, dividend equivalents and a subsequent change in control are not less favorable to the Participant than the terms and conditions of this Award.

Without limiting the generality of the foregoing, the Replacement Award may take the form of a continuation of this Award or such other form approved by the Committee provided that the preceding requirements of this subsection are satisfied. The determination of whether the requirements are satisfied shall be made by the Committee, as constituted immediately prior to the Change in Control, in its sole discretion. In the event of a Change in Control, Participant agrees to accept a Replacement Award meeting the above conditions in substitution of this Award.

“Good Reason” means: (1) a change in the Participant’s job title or position, which results in a material diminution in authority, duties or responsibilities; (2) any material breach by the Company (or its successor) of this agreement or any material obligation of the Company for the payment or provision of compensation or other benefits to the Participant; (3) a material diminution in Participant’s compensation or a failure by the Company (or its successor) to provide an arrangement for the Participant for any fiscal year of the Company (or its successor) giving the Participant the opportunity to earn an incentive award for such year; or (4) the Company (or its successor) requires Participant to materially change the location of Participant’s primary tax home ; provided such new location is one in excess of 35 miles from the location of Participant’s primary tax home before such change. In order to constitute a termination for “Good Reason,” the Participant must provide the Company (or its successor) with notice of the event constituting Good Reason within 60 days of the initial occurrence thereof, the Company (or its successor) shall have 30 days to cure such event and, if the event is not cured within such period, the Participant must resign for Good Reason effective no later than 30 days following the Company’s failure to cure the event.
